Why HumanKIND?

At Humankind Fine Arts & Film Studio, we’re all about capturing life as it really is…authentic, emotional, and beautifully human. Whether it’s through a photography session, filmmaking, or a music project, we aim to tell stories that feel real and resonate deeply.

Our founder, Miriam Hogans, started this journey after a mission trip to Brazil, where she found herself surrounded by the kind of honest, powerful moments that can’t be staged. Those experiences in Manaus and Coari shaped the heart of what Humankind is today.

Part of our mission is to grow a creative space in Texas through events, where up-and-coming Christian filmmakers, who do not have a platform, can boldly share their stories and faith in Jesus.

Manaus Brazil

A city where the Rio Negro and Amazon River meet but never mix. Located in the State of the Amazonas, surrounded by the lush Amazon Rainforest and beautiful animals.

A city where traveling by boat is common. Coari is located in the State of the Amazonas with floating homes and gas stations that sit on the Amazon River. Its culture is deep and the people and food are rich and beautifully made.

Coari Brazil
